Finance
What will I have to pay?
If you accept a training place with us then you will be expected to pay tuition fees of £8,500. If you are recruited to a salaried place then the school which employs you will pay us your fees and you can expect to receive an unqualified teacher’s salary. You will be expected to fund all your travel costs.
Financial help
To cover the cost of studying, trainees can apply for:
- a Tuition Fee Loan - to cover the tuition fees in full
- a Maintenance Loan - for living costs like rent
- a Maintenance Grant - if your household income is less than £42,600
Further information about the above can be found by logging on to www.gov.uk/student-finance/overview. Extra help is also available if you have a disability or children or adults dependent on you. Details can be found at the Directgov website. Some of our member schools offer training bursaries to suitable candidates following their successful recruitment to the course.
Payment of tuition fees
You can either pay us directly or through the Student Loans Company.
Please note that the recommendation for Qualified Teacher Status and achievement of the Post Graduate Certificate in Education award will be withheld from any trainee who fails to honour all monetary debts. The trainee is liable for the relevant course fees whether or not the course is completed.
